Abstract

A warming device includes a clinical garment having an inside surface supporting a convective apparatus with multiple separately inflatable sections, each adapted to enable a particular mode of warming.

Claims (17)

1. A warming device, comprising:

a clinical garment with an inside surface;

a convective apparatus supported on the inside surface;

the convective apparatus including a first, dog-bone shaped, section to provide comfort warming by convection and a second section framing the dog-bone shaped section to provide therapeutic warming by convection.

2. The warming device of claim 1 , wherein the first and second sections are separately inflatable and each includes a permeable surface facing the interior of the clinical garment.

3. The warming device of claim 2 , in which the first section includes one inlet port and the second section includes two inlet ports, further including plugs closing inlet ports to prevent air escaping therethrough.

4. The warming device of claim 2 , in which the first section includes one inlet port and the second section includes two inlet ports, wherein the inlet ports are through a surface of the convective apparatus.

5. The warming device of claim 2 , in which the first section includes one inlet port and the second section includes two inlet ports, wherein each inlet port comprises a collar of stiff material with an opening to receive the nozzle of an air hose.

6. The warming device of claim 2 , in which the first section includes one inlet port and the second section includes two inlet ports, wherein each inlet port comprises a sleeve of material.

7. The warming device of claim 1 , the clinical garment further including sleeves, in which a portion of at least one sleeve is separable from a corresponding portion of the sleeve.

8. The warming device of claim 7 , further including means for releasably joining the sleeve portions.

9. The warming device of claim 7 , wherein each sleeve has a slit along its entire length, on the top of the sleeve.

10. The warming device of claim 9 , including one of buttons, snaps, repositionable adhesive, hook and eye elements, double-sided adhesive, hook and loop, and rivets for closing the slits.

11. The warming device of claim 1 , including a strip of double-sided adhesive on the convective apparatus for securing the warming device to a person.

12. The warming device of claim 1 , wherein the clinical garment is one of a hospital gown, a robe, and a bib.

13. The warming device of claim 1 , wherein the clinical garment is a gown having one of a rear opening, a front opening, and a side opening.

14. The warming device of claim 1 , wherein the clinical garment is a poncho type gown having a head opening.
